*{margin: 0px;
  padding: 0px;
}
body{
  font-family: 宋体, 新细明体, Verdana, Arial, sans-serif;
  font-size: 12px; line-height:22px; text-align: center;
  color: #000000;
}
form{
  margin: 0px; padding: 0px;
}
/* 表格样式 */
table{
	text-align: left;
	font: 12px/120%;
}
table td{
}
table.fix{
	table-layout: fixed;
}
table.fix td{
	white-space:nowrap;
	overflow: hidden;
	text-overflow:ellipsis;
	-o-text-overflow:ellipsis;
}
table.grid{
	border-collapse: collapse;
	border: 1px solid #EEB06D;
	padding: 2px;
	margin: auto;
	font-size:12px;
	line-height:25px;
}
table.grid caption, .gridtop{
	border: 1px solid #EEB06D;
	background:url(images/as.gif) ;
    padding:absolute;
	vertical-align: middle; 
	text-align: center;
	color:#9A5000;
	font-weight: bold;
	font-size: 14px;
	margin: auto;
	line-height:28px;
}
table.grid th, .head{
	border: 1px solid #EEB06D;
	color:#333;
	font-size:12px;
	text-align: center;
	font-weight: bold;
}
table.grid td{
	border: 1px solid #EEB06D;
	padding: 3px;
	background-color: #FDF1E4 !important; 
}
table.hide, table.hide th, table.hide td{
	border: 0;
}
div {
  text-align: left;
}
a{
 color:#996633;
  text-decoration: none;
  font-size:12px;
  background-color: transparent;
}
a:hover{
  color: #FF0000;
}
hr{
  height: 1px;
  border: #83b0e1 1px solid;
}
ul{
  margin: 0px; 
  padding: 0px;
  list-style-type: none; 
  text-align: left;
  clear: both;
}
li{
  list-style-type: none; 
  line-height: 150%;
}
.main{
  width:960px; height:30px;
  clear: both;
  text-align: center;
  margin:0 auto;
}
.m_top{
  height:30px; line-height:30px;
  border-bottom:solid 1px #DCDCDC;
}
.m_head{
  height:55;  margin:10px auto 10px auto;
}
.h_logo{
  float:left;
  width:126px; height:57px; float:left;
}
.h_banner{
  float:left; width:488px; height:60px; margin-left:19px;
}
.h_link{
  float:right;
  margin-bottom:15px; width:312px; height:20px;
}
.m_menu{
	background:url(images/mu.gif) no-repeat;
	width:960px;
	height:35px;
	margin:10px auto;
	display: block; line-height:35px; color:#FFF; font-size:13px; font-weight:bold;
}

#left{
	float: left;
	width: 231px;
	margin-right:6px;
}

#right{
	float: right;
	width: 231px;
}

#centers{
  float: left;
  width: 486px;
}

#centerm{
  float: left;
  width: 720px;
}
#centerl{
  float: left;
  width: 960px;
}
#content{

}
.block{
  width: 100%;
  margin-bottom: 5px;
}
.blocktitle{
  font-weight: bold; 
  font-size: 14px; 
  background-color: #FBE6CE;
  color: #9A5000; 
  line-height: 30px; 
  padding-left: 12px;
  border: 1px solid #c6c6c6;
}
.blockcontent{
  padding: 3px;
  border-left: 1px solid #c6c6c6;
  border-right: 1px solid #c6c6c6;
  border-bottom: 1px solid #c6c6c6;
}
.blocknote{
  border-top: #83b0e1 1px solid;
  padding: 3px;
  text-align: center;
  background: #F0F7FF;
  line-height: 150%;
}

#left .block, #right .block{
	padding-bottom: 8px;
    background: url("images/b.gif") no-repeat 0% 100%;
}

#left .blocktitle, #right .blocktitle {
    border: 0px;
	padding-left: 23px;
	height: 30px;
	line-height: 30px; 
	text-align: left;
	background-image:url(images/a_44.gif);
 }
#left .blockcontent, #right .blockcontent {
    border-left: 1px solid #eeb06d;
    border-right: 1px solid #eeb06d;
	border-bottom: 0px;
 }
#centers .blocktitle {
 height: 31px;
 background-image:url(images/a_45.gif);
 border: 0px;
}

input{
    font-size: 12px; 
}
.text{
	border: red 1px solid; 
	height: 16px; 
	background-color: #ffffff;
	color: #054e86;
	height: 20px;
}
.textarea{
	border: #83b0e1 1px solid; 
	color: #054e86; 
	background-color: #ffffff;
	font-size: 12px; 
}
.button{
    background-color: #fbe6ce;
    border: red 1px solid;
    color: #000000;
    height: 20px;
}
.checkbox, .radio{
    border-width: 0; 
}
.select{
	font-size: 12px; 
	height: 18px;
	
}
.hottext{
  color: #FF0000;
}
.gridtop{
  border-top: 1px solid #83b0e1;
  border-left: 1px solid #83b0e1;
  border-right: 1px solid #83b0e1;
  background: #e0edff;
  vertical-align: middle; 
  text-align: center;
  padding: 3px;
  color:#054e86;
  font-size: 14px;
  font-weight: bold;
}
.title{
  vertical-align: middle; 
  text-align: center;
  font-size: 14px;
  font-weight: bold;
  color:#9A5000;
  line-height:25px;
  background-color:#FF0000;
}
.head{
  font-size: 12px;
  font-weight: bold;
}
.even{
  background: #FFFFFF; 
  padding: 3px;
}
.odd{
  background: #FFFFFF; 
  padding: 3px;
}
.foot{
  background: #FBE6CE; 
  padding: 3px; 
  text-align: center;
}
/*  foot  start */
.m_foot{
    width:960px; 
	height:32px  !important;
	background-image:url(images/a_82.gif);
	margin:0 auto;
	line-height:32px; 
	text-align:center;
	float:none;
	overflow :auto;
	
}
#bo2{ width:960px;
     height:50px !important ; 
	 text-align:center;
	 margin:5px auto 10px auto;
	 float:none;
	 overflow:auto;
	}
/* foot end */			

.jieqiQuote {
	border: #000000 1px solid; 
	padding: 2px; 
	font-size: 12px; 
	color: #000000; 
	background-color: #83b0e1;
}
.jieqiCode {
	border: #000000 1px solid; 
	padding: 2px; 
	font-size: 12px; 
	color: #000000; 
	background-color: #83b0e1;
}
.popbox{
	position:absolute;
	width:190px !important;
	height:110px !important;
	width:200px;
	height:120px;
	border: 1px solid #83b0e1;
	background: #F0F7FF;
	color: #FF0000;
	font-size: 12px;
	line-height:120%;
	padding: 3px;
	display:none;
	z-index:9999;
}
.ultop li{list-style: circle inside; margin-left: 3px;}
.ulitem ul{list-style-type:none;}
.ulitem li{
	line-height:22px;
}
.ulitem li a{
	margin:0px 0px 0px 20px;
}
.ulitem2 ul{list-style-type:none;}
.ulitem2 li{
	margin-left:20px;
	list-style-position: inside; float:right;
}
.ulrow li{padding:3px;}
.ulcenter li{text-align: center;}

.ulmul{overflow: hidden; float:inherit;}
.ulmul li{ float:left;  
}
.lm{white-space:nowrap; text-overflow:ellipsis; -o-text-overflow:ellipsis; overflow: hidden;}
.fl{float:left;}
.fr{float:right;}
.cl{clear:left;}
.cr{clear:right;}
.cb{clear:both;}
.tl{text-align:left;}
.tc{text-align:center;}
.tr{text-align:right;}
.more{text-align: right;}
#jieqi_menu{
	line-height: 20px;
	list-style-type: none;
}
#jieqi_menu a{
	display: block;
	width: 60px;
	text-align: center;
}
#jieqi_menu a:link{
	color: #333;
	text-decoration: none;
}
#jieqi_menu a:visited{
	color: #ffffff;
	text-decoration: none;
}
#jieqi_menu a:hover{
	color: #ff6600;
	text-decoration: none;
}
#jieqi_menu li{
	float: left;
	width: 85px;
	font-size:25px;
}
#jieqi_menu li a:hover{
	background:#E2E5E5;
}
#jieqi_menu li ul{
	line-height: 20px;
	list-style: none;
	text-align: left;
	display: none;
	width: 60px;
	position: absolute;
	border: 1px solid  #ccc;
    font-size:12px;
}
#jieqi_menu li ul li{
	float: left;
	width: 90px;
	background:white;
	font-size:12px;
}
#jieqi_menu li ul a{
	display: block;
	width: 80px !important;
	width: 90px;
	text-align:left;
	padding-left:10px;
}
#jieqi_menu li ul a:link{
	color:#333;
	text-decoration:none;
}
#jieqi_menu li ul a:visited{
	color:#333;
	text-decoration:none;
}
#jieqi_menu li ul a:hover{
	color:red;
	text-decoration:none;
	font-weight:normal;
	background:#E5E5E5;
}
#jieqi_menu li:hover ul{
	display: block;
}
#jieqi_menu li.sfhover ul{
	display: block;
}
#jieqi_menu li.nohover ul{
	display: hide;
}
.pages{
	padding: 5px 0px;
}
.pagelink{
	border: 1px solid #fbe6ce;
	float: right;
	background: #fbe6ce;
	line-height:24px;
	padding:0;
}
.pagelink a, .pagelink strong, .pagelink em, .pagelink kbd, .pagelink a.first, .pagelink a.last, .pagelink a.prev, .pagelink a.next, .pagelink a.pgroup, .pagelink a.ngroup{
	float: left;
	padding: 0 6px;
}
.pagelink a:hover{background-color: #ffffff; }
.pagelink strong{font-weight: bold; color: #ff6600; background: white;}
.pagelink kbd{height:24px; border-left: 1px solid #EEB06D;}
.pagelink em{height:24px; border-right: 1px solid #EEB06D; font-style:normal;}
.pagelink input{border: 1px solid #EEB06D; color: #054e86; margin-top:1px; height: 18px;}
.ajaxtip{
	position:absolute;
	border: 1px solid #a3bee8;
	background: #f0f7ff;
	color: #ff0000;
	font-size: 12px;
	line-height:120%;
	padding: 3px;
	display:none;
	z-index:1000;
}
#tips {
	border: 1px solid #a3bee8;
	padding: 3px;
	display: none;
	background: #f0f7ff;
	position: absolute;
}
.red{font-size:14px; font-weight:bold;}
/* top */
#top{width:960px; height:30px; border-bottom:solid 1px #DCDCDC; margin:0 auto;}
#Welcome{width:310px; height:30px; float:left; line-height:30px;}
#Welcome a{text-decoration:none; color:#FF0000;}
#Font{width:325px; height:30px; float:right; line-height:30px;}
#Font a{color:#000; text-decoration:none;}
#Font a:hover{color:#FF0000;}
#Font img{margin:0px 13px 0px 13px;}
#Search{width:312px; height:20px; float:right;}
#Search ul{list-style-type:none;}
#Search li{float:left; margin-left:5px;}

